by Jeff Cox, 253 pages. The book is subtitled, 'A Complete Guide to Growing Grapes & Making Your Own Wine'. The author helps you select the best varieties for your climate. Using 90 'how to' drawings, he explains how to plant, trellis, prune, control pests and make fine wine.
by Anne Proulx, 32 pages Learn how to plant, trellis, care for and harvest grapes in your backyard. A Garden Way booklet.
By Anine Grumbles, 147 pages For years the author has advised home winemakers about making wines without sulfites. She has recipes for wines from many fruits and she outlines all the ingredients and equipment a home winemaker will need.
By Lon Rombough,304 pages,subtitled,'A Guide to Organic Viticulture'. Everything you need to know including planting,training,porpagating,pest control,folklore and choosing the best varieties for each climate,from a long time expert!
